Meet Bernie – A Shy Teddy Bear with a Heart of Gold
If you’re looking for a gentle soul wrapped in soft fur, Bernie might just be your perfect match. This sweet boy can be a little shy when meeting new people, but give him a bit of time and patience, and you’ll soon discover his true personality — a warm, snuggly teddy bear who will happily melt into your heart.
Once Bernie feels safe, his affectionate side shines. He adores quiet moments spent getting chin scritches, or simply lounging beside you as the world drifts by. Outside, Bernie’s happiest with his nose to the ground, taking in all the wonderful smells nature has to offer. Whether it’s a leisurely walk or a sunny afternoon soaking up fresh air, Bernie finds joy in life’s peaceful moments.
This clever pup already has excellent manners — he’s potty trained, crate trained, knows his name, and has solid leash skills. He’s also eager to learn and would love to continue growing with a patient family who enjoys gentle training sessions (and plenty of treats — he’s quite the cookie connoisseur!).
Bernie would thrive in a calm, quiet home where he can take his time to settle in and feel secure. He’d also be perfectly happy sharing his space with a friendly canine companion who can show him the ropes.
If you’re searching for a loyal friend who will reward your kindness with unconditional love and quiet companionship, Bernie is waiting to meet you.

A one-of-a-kind animal welfare organization, Anderson Humane focuses on creating and supporting mutually beneficial relationships between people and animals. Current programming such as our Adoption Program, Military Veterans’ Program, and Healing Paws Pet Therapy Program create positive, impactful connections between people and animals, improving the lives of both. Future programs will be offered in partnership with human-service organizations throughout our community, maximizing impact and changing lives for the better.
Anderson Humane is a resource for pet owners, providing information and services to provide better care for their pets. Services such as our Low-Cost Vaccination, Dental, and Spay/Neuter Clinics offer affordable veterinary care options, preventing owners from having to give up their pets simply because they can’t afford care. On the horizon are additional programs to keep pets in homes, such as a pet food pantry, affordable pet training options, and temporary housing for pets when families are in crisis.
